ZNF624 Antibody (F-7): sc-515366

5.0(1)
Write a reviewAsk a question

Datasheets
  • ZNF624 Antibody (F-7) is a mouse monoclonal IgM κ provided at 200 µg/ml
  • specific for an epitope mapping between amino acids 31-47 near the N-terminus of ZNF624 of human origin
  • recommended for detection of ZNF624 of human origin, Gm3055 of mouse origin and LOC100909569 of rat origin by WB, IP, IF and ELISA
  • At present, we have not yet completed the identification of the preferred secondary detection reagent(s) for ZNF624 Antibody (F-7). This work is in progress.

Zinc finger protein 624 (ZNF624) is a crucial member of the Krüppel C2H2-type zinc-finger protein family, consisting of 739 amino acids and localized primarily in the nucleus. ZNF624 is characterized by 21 C2H2-type zinc fingers, which play a significant role in DNA-binding and transcriptional regulation. ZNF624′s ability to interact with specific DNA sequences allows modulation of gene expression, making ZNF624 essential for various cellular processes, including development and differentiation. ZNF624 participates in the recruitment of histone-modifying proteins through interaction with KAP1, thereby influencing chromatin structure and function. ZNF624′s versatility in regulating transcription highlights its importance in maintaining cellular homeostasis and responding to environmental signals, underscoring anti-ZNF624 antibody (F-7)′s relevance in research applications aimed at understanding gene regulation and expression in different biological contexts.

    What application is the blocking peptide sc-515366 P appropriate for?

    Asked by: Germaine
    Thank you for your question. The blocking peptide is intended for use as a negative control, by pre-adsorbing the mouse monoclonal antibody against the antigen.
